    I think there was already a thread for an early version of this a while ago, but I thought I'd start anew with a new thread for the (nearly) finished custom that has been in production for a long while.

    This is my custom Classics Huffer, made out of my old Cybertron scout class Armorhide figure, that was somewhat of a junker.







    As can be seen from some of these pics, he needs a few minor touch ups around the edge of the face and another coat of purple on the helmet. The inside of the legs could do with a bit of paint as well. The back hood thing is made out of card for the moment and I need to integrate some kind of joint on it so it can fit in vehicle mode.
